Currently only caretakers or those with eject rights can use
aw_teleport. This is probably to prevent jokers from sending people to
arbitrary locations. But couldn't this method be used safely if the
person teleported by the bot was also the bot's owner? (the SDK would
have to check that the session_id was a session_id of the citizen_number
used to start the bot)? If someone makes their own bots teleport them to
bot-selected locations, then they have only themselves to blame if they
don't like being teleported.

The documents say that "this method is primarily intended to allow
bots to teleport human users around in a world". But, as described, it
is a privilege only given to citizens who have worlds of their own. It
would be nice for ordinary AW citizens to offer tours of their property
on public worlds like AlphaWorld, Mars, or Meta. If aw_teleport were
extended as described above (the person teleported must be the bot's
owner), you could offer tours of your property on public worlds.
Ordinary AW citizens could script a tour & then post it on a website for
download. Anybody could then get the tour script & run it on their own
TourGuide Bot, which would teleport its clients from location to
location, on all the AW worlds.
